ncurses 5.9 - patch 20120218
[ncurses.git] / progs / dump_entry.h
index 1f4a52a180d3ac7eefc8031c357190ea29507975..807b51c0297ae6a0020c8df8aecdefe7bb9aa44e 100644 (file)
@@ -1,5 +1,5 @@
 /****************************************************************************
- * Copyright (c) 1998-2002,2004 Free Software Foundation, Inc.              *
+ * Copyright (c) 1998-2008,2011 Free Software Foundation, Inc.              *
  *                                                                          *
  * Permission is hereby granted, free of charge, to any person obtaining a  *
  * copy of this software and associated documentation files (the            *
@@ -32,9 +32,8 @@
  *     and: Thomas E. Dickey                        1996-on                 *
  ****************************************************************************/
 
-
 /*
- * $Id: dump_entry.h,v 1.27 2004/12/04 15:37:17 tom Exp $
+ * $Id: dump_entry.h,v 1.32 2011/08/06 16:33:05 tom Exp $
  *
  * Dump control definitions and variables
  */
 #define CMP_USE                3       /* comparison on use capabilities */
 
 typedef unsigned PredType;
-typedef int PredIdx;
-typedef int (*PredFunc)(PredType, PredIdx);
+typedef unsigned PredIdx;
+typedef int (*PredFunc) (PredType, PredIdx);
+typedef void (*PredHook) (PredType, PredIdx, const char *);
 
 extern NCURSES_CONST char *nametrans(const char *);
-extern void dump_init(const char *, int, int, int, int, bool);
 extern int fmt_entry(TERMTYPE *, PredFunc, bool, bool, bool, int);
-extern int dump_entry(TERMTYPE *, bool, bool, int, int, PredFunc);
-extern int dump_uses(const char *, bool);
-extern void compare_entry(void (*)(PredType, PredIdx, const char *), TERMTYPE *, bool);
-extern void repair_acsc(TERMTYPE * tp);
+extern int show_entry(void);
+extern void compare_entry(PredHook, TERMTYPE *, bool);
+extern void dump_entry(TERMTYPE *, bool, bool, int, PredFunc);
+extern void dump_init(const char *, int, int, int, int, unsigned, bool);
+extern void dump_uses(const char *, bool);
+extern void repair_acsc(TERMTYPE *tp);
 
 #define FAIL   -1